Size Considerations
Size plays a crucial role in the maneuverability and coverage efficiency of robotic vacuums. Smaller devices can navigate tight spaces more easily, while larger units may cover more ground per charge but struggle in confined areas.
Ecovacs Size Features
- Compact design with a diameter of approximately 13-14 inches.
- Height typically around 3.8-4.2 inches, enabling access under low furniture.
- Lightweight construction for easy portability and storage.
Roborock Size Features
- Generally larger in size, with diameters around 14-15 inches.
- Heights ranging from 3.8 to 4.3 inches, optimized for thorough cleaning.
- Bulkier build may limit access to very tight spaces.
Resolution and Sensor Technology
Resolution in robotic vacuums refers to the clarity and detail of the sensors and cameras used for mapping and monitoring. Higher resolution allows for more precise navigation and obstacle detection, leading to more efficient cleaning cycles.
Ecovacs Resolution Capabilities
- Utilizes advanced LiDAR sensors with high-resolution mapping capabilities.
- Some models feature 3D mapping for detailed environment understanding.
- Camera integration for real-time obstacle recognition.
Roborock Resolution Capabilities
- Equipped with high-precision LiDAR sensors for accurate mapping.
- Some models incorporate multi-layered sensors for better resolution.
- Enhanced camera systems for detailed environment monitoring.
Impact on Monitoring Efficiency
Size and resolution directly influence the effectiveness of monitoring. Smaller devices with high-resolution sensors can navigate complex layouts and identify obstacles more accurately, reducing missed spots and improving overall cleaning quality.
For example, Ecovacs’ compact models with 3D mapping excel in environments with furniture and clutter. Roborock’s larger units with multi-layered sensors provide comprehensive coverage in open spaces, making them suitable for larger homes.
